How Magic Card Values Are Determined

Magic card values are influenced by condition and grades assigned by professional services, rarity and the effect of the Reserved List, as well as demand in tournament formats and among Commander players. Limited print runs and collectible interest, coupled with recent market sales, also play crucial roles in pricing.

Tips Before Selling Your Magic: The Gathering Collection

  • Segment Reserved List and high-value cards clearly.
  • Separate Commander staples for interested deck builders.
  • Organize singles by condition and rarity.
  • Confirm and document grades for any graded cards.
  • Research recent market comparisons before pricing.
  • Protect valuable cards during handling and shipping.
  • Understand cash versus retail sale distinctions.
  • Consult multiple buyers for best offers.

What Magic cards are worth the most?

Power Nine cards, Reserved List cards, graded singles, and sealed booster boxes often hold the greatest value.

Are Reserved List cards valuable?

Yes, their scarcity and limited reprints make them highly collectible and valuable.

Can I sell an entire MTG collection?

Yes, entire collections are frequently sold and may appeal to a variety of buyers.

Should I grade valuable Magic cards before selling?

Grading can increase a card's value and buyer confidence but involves additional costs and timing.
